hey honda people, I picked up my very first Honda...well, car wise.

I picked up a 97 Civic Sedan LX for a daily driver....it needs some body work, so I was curious if the 99-00 EX, SI bumper (front & rear) would work. Someone said I had to change out my headlights, hood, and fenders and do some cutting? is that true? being a honda noob, they look similar am I missing something?

The '96-'98 front end and the '99-'00 front end are totally different.

All '96-'98 USDM Civic coupe, hatch and sedan fronts are the same, though the grille on the sedans is different (but interchangeable).

All '99-'00 Civic coupe, hatch and sedan fronts are the same, though here in the US the Si has a different grille, as so the sedans.

Sedan grilles have a different number of fins and a chrome shell. Coupes and hatches have a painted shell. The Si has a painted shell and a mesh interior instead of fins.

The Si gets a standard front lip, while the other trims have the same lip as an option. The Si body is the same as any other '99-'00 coupe, except it gets all color matched trim. All trims have optional fog lights and rear lips. The Si had painted sideskirts stock, but the other trims could get these as an option too.

In order to put a '99-'00 front end on your '96-'98, you'll need:
Headlights
Front bumper
Fenders
Hood
Grille
Core support (optional - you can hammer in th stock corners or cut into your new bumper)

The coupes and sedans also have a different rear bumper (it turns out slightly at the bottom on the '99-'00s) and the taillights on the coupe anf hatch are red and white for '99-'00, while they're red, amber and white for '96-'98. The trunk and taillights for the sedans also changed.

The climate control panels inside the cars also changed, and can be a bit of work to convert from one to another.
